
Sustratos cromogénicos
Los sustratos cromogénicos son compuestos que producen un cambio de color visible cuando son metabolizados por enzimas específicas. Estos sustratos se utilizan ampliamente en ensayos diagnósticos, investigaciones bioquímicas y ensayos de inmunoabsorción enzimática (ELISA) para detectar y cuantificar la actividad enzimática. El cambio de color permite una identificación visual rápida y sencilla de las reacciones enzimáticas, lo que convierte a los sustratos cromogénicos en herramientas esenciales en el análisis de laboratorio. CAS:<p>A substrate for visualising alkaline phosphatase activity. Produces a red colored insoluble end product that is detected visually, when used together with Nitroblue tetrazolium. The substrate system is versatile and functions in a variety of applications, including Northern, Southern, and Western blotting, in situ hybridization, ELISAs and immunohistochemistry. <p>Espresso-Gal (Espresso-beta-D-galactopyranoside) is a chromogenic indicator for beta-galactosidase activity. The colorless product is cleaved by lactose-utilizing bacteria in liquid media or on agar plates and yields an espresso brown colored precipitate. Espresso-Gal can also be used as detecting agent for beta-galactosidase activity in reporter gene assays or for identification of positive transformants on agar plates when using the α-complementation approach. CAS:<p>4-Nitrophenyl phosphate bis(cyclohexylammonium) is an excellent chromogenic substrate designed for the detection and quantification of phosphatase enzyme activities. Aided by the presence of the cyclohexylammonium cation, it undergoes enzymatic hydrolysis, yielding the colored 4-nitrophenolate ion, which can be readily observed at 405 nm.
